Chipotle Turkey Burger Recipe

This chipotle turkey burger is juicy, spicy, and easy to make. Packed with smoky chipotle flavor, it’s a delicious alternative to beef and perfect for grilling.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Course Main Course
Cuisine American
Servings 4 burgers

Equipment

  • mixing bowl
  • Grill or stovetop skillet
  • Spatula

Ingredients
  

  • 1 pound ground turkey 93% lean for the best juiciness
  • 1 chipotle pepper in adobo sauce minced (add more if you like it spicy)
  • 1 tablespoon adobo sauce from the chipotle can
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ground cumin
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/4 cup breadcrumbs helps the burgers hold their shape
  • 1 egg lightly beaten

Optional Toppings:

  • Sliced avocado
  • Pepper jack cheese
  • Fresh lettuce leaves
  • Tomato slices
  • Chipotle mayo just mix mayo with a little adobo sauce

Instructions
 

Step 1: Mix the turkey burger mixture

  • In a large mixing bowl, combine the ground turkey, minced chipotle pepper, adobo sauce, smoked paprika, garlic powder, onion powder, cumin, salt, black pepper, breadcrumbs, and egg.
  • Use your hands or a spoon to gently mix everything together until evenly combined. Be careful not to overmix, this can make the burgers tough.

Step 2: Shape the patties

  • Divide the mixture into four equal portions. Shape each portion into a patty about 3/4 inch thick. Make a small indentation in the center of each patty with your thumb, this helps them cook evenly and prevents them from puffing up.

Step 3: Cook the burgers

  • Heat a grill or skillet over medium heat. Lightly coat the surface with oil to prevent sticking.
  • Place the patties on the grill or skillet and cook for about 4–5 minutes per side, or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F. Avoid pressing down on the patties while cooking to keep them juicy.

Step 4: Add toppings and serve

  • Once cooked, let the patties rest for a minute or two. Then, assemble your burgers with your favorite toppings.
  • I love adding creamy avocado, pepper jack cheese, and a drizzle of chipotle mayo for an extra kick. Serve on a toasted bun, and enjoy!
